Due To Different Names In Aadhar Card And Khatauni, Land Verification Is Not Being Done, Farmers Are Making Rounds Of Officials.

Land verification is not happening due to different names in Aadhar card and Khatauni.

Jagran correspondent, Hardoi. Farmers are worried about selling paddy at government purchasing centres. 23,787 farmers have registered to sell paddy at the government purchasing centre, but due to delay in verification, farmers are facing problems.

4,822 farmers are stuck due to difference in name in Aadhar card and Khatauni and verification of land. Due to PFMS, verification of 333 farmers is not being done. Farmers are making rounds of officials for verification. Paddy procurement has started in the district from October 1. The government has set a target of purchasing two lakh 33 thousand metric tonnes of paddy. To achieve the target, 128 purchasing centers of six purchasing agencies have been opened.

23,787 farmers have registered to sell paddy at government purchasing centres, but paddy of 10,891 farmers could not be purchased. The district administration claims that 91,118.58 metric tonnes of paddy has been purchased from 12,896 farmers.

The records of 6,069 registered farmers have been verified, while the names of 4,822 farmers have mismatch in Aadhar card and Khatauni. Land verification has not been done. Farmers are circling the tehsil to get the verification done.

District Food Marketing Officer Niharika said that if there is a difference in the name in Aadhaar card and Khatauni and there is no verification of land, tokens will be issued to the farmers. Paddy will be purchased from all the farmers.

Farmers are facing difficulty in selling paddy at the centers of Madhauganj.

The arbitrariness of the in-charges at the government paddy procurement centers opened to provide benefits of the Minimum Support Price (MSP) scheme is not showing any signs of stopping. Farmers are facing problems in selling paddy at the centers of Madhauganj. Farmer Dilip Yadav said that even after having the token, it is becoming difficult to sell paddy at the purchasing centres.

Farmer Mukesh Kumar Verma told that for weighing the paddy, diesel is being taken from the farmers to run the weeder and generator. This is causing problems.
